Subject: DR drill Wednesday — MeshCal sync

Hi! Welcome aboard. Quick note: Wednesday we're drilling a disaster-recovery scenario for MeshCal, simulating the calendar sync conflict that duplicated events last spring. You'll shadow the restore steps — nothing scary. To open the drill environment's sealed backup, you'll need the recovery phrase, which I'm including right below.

vault phrase of bagaf-kajeg = jorath-feniel-briir-siliel-ralix

## Deploying the Gatewick Proctor Queue

Deploys are pretty painless: push to main, wait for the pipeline, then watch the queue drain dashboard for five minutes. If candidates pile up mid-exam, roll back first and ask questions later — the queue replays safely. Everything the workers care about lives in one config block, shown here for reference.

settings of bafof-yagef:
JOROX_PIN=8740
JOROX_TENANT=pelox
JOROX_METRICS_HOST=metrics.jorox.qorvelworks.internal
JOROX_SEAL=seal_c78f63c1
JOROX_STANDBY_TEAM=norax

Handover — Vexler partner SFTP drop

Ownership moves to you today. Drop runs hourly from Vexler's end into the intake bucket via the relay host. Watch for zero-byte files; their exporter flakes on Mondays. Creds live in the ops vault, path noted in the runbook. Vault auto-seals after 48h idle. Support escalations go to the on-call rotation, not me. If the vault is sealed when you need it, unseal with the recovery passphrase below.

recovery phrase for tadug-fafof: zorwyn-kasion

Squatwatch checks every declared dependency in your plugin manifest against its registry of known typo-squatted names. Scans run at publish time; a positive match blocks the release. False positives go through the appeal queue — don't just rename the dependency to dodge the check, that gets flagged too. Private registries are supported if mirrored through the Halloway proxy. Edit distance threshold is fixed at two; you cannot override it per-plugin. Your plugin's build step must supply the scanner with the following configuration values.

service settings:
[silwyn]
host = silwyn.crelvogrid.internal
user = silwyn_svc
database = silwyn_prod